3-Day Desert Tour from Marrakech (Merzouga)

This is Morocco's most popular desert tour: 3 days / 2 nights from Marrakech to the Merzouga dunes, through the south's finest scenery. A legendary route combining kasbahs, gorges, palm groves and an unforgettable night in the Sahara.

The 3-day / 2-night Marrakech → Merzouga desert tour follows a classic route: Day 1, Aït Ben Haddou and Ouarzazate then the Dadès gorges; Day 2, the Todra gorges and arrival in Merzouga with a night at camp after a camel ride; Day 3, sunrise then the return to Marrakech. Plan around €90-160/person in a group.

Day-by-day itinerary

DayProgrammeNight
Day 1Marrakech → Tizi n'Tichka pass → Aït Ben Haddou (UNESCO) → Ouarzazate → Dadès valley and gorgesHotel/kasbah in the Dadès gorges
Day 2Todra gorges → Tinghir → Road of a Thousand Kasbahs → Merzouga → camel ride at sunsetCamp in the Erg Chebbi dunes
Day 3Sunrise over the dunes → breakfast → long drive back to Marrakech (via Ouarzazate)

It's a packed itinerary: the first two days are rich in scenery, the third is mainly the return (8-9 h drive). See the full Merzouga desert guide.

What's usually included

  • Transport in an air-conditioned 4x4 or minibus, driver.
  • 1 night in a hotel/kasbah + 1 night at camp.
  • Breakfasts and dinners (half board).
  • Camel ride at sunset.

Often not included: lunches, drinks, some site entries, tips, and the luxury camp upgrade.

How much does it cost?

OptionIndicative price/person
Shared group (3 days)€90-160
Luxury camp (supplement)+€50-150
Private tour (by group)on request, higher

Prices vary by season, comfort level and group size. Always check what's included before booking.

FAQ — 3-day desert tour from Marrakech

Is the 3-day desert tour worth it?

Yes, it's the best way to reach the real Merzouga dunes from Marrakech. The scenery of the first two days (Aït Ben Haddou, gorges) and the night in the dunes are well worth the long drive.

What is the 3-day tour itinerary?

Day 1: Aït Ben Haddou, Ouarzazate, Dadès gorges. Day 2: Todra gorges, Merzouga, camel ride and night at camp. Day 3: sunrise then the return to Marrakech.

How much does the 3-day desert tour cost?

Around €90-160 per person in a shared group, more privately or with a luxury camp. Check what's included (nights, meals, camel ride).

Can you do the desert from Marrakech in under 3 days?

For Merzouga, no: the distance requires 3 days. For a shorter option, go to the Zagora desert in 2 days, or Agafay (40 min from Marrakech) for a single night.

What should I pack for the desert tour?

A warm jacket for the night, a scarf against sand, closed shoes, water, a head torch, sunscreen and some cash for lunches and tips.
